Research Abstract

The purpose of this study is to construct integrated models mathematically for scheduling problems that arise in FMS (flexible manufacturing systems) and to develop their optimal solution methods.
Atypical FMS consists of machining centers with many kinds of cutting tools, AGVs (automated guided vehicles), robots and anAS/RS (automated store and retrieval system). Especially, a small-sized FMS with a few machining centers is called FMC (flexible manufacturing cell), and a FMS with one robot a robotic cell.
The outline of the results obtained in this study is as follows.
(1) An efficient exact algorithm was developed for a FMC scheduling problem that has two machining centers, and an intermediate station between them for washing and cooling parts processed.
(2) Approximate algorithms that give more accurate solutions than previous ones were developed for robotic cell scheduling problems that have two or three machining centers, each having a finite buffer.
(3) An exact solution algorithm based on a branch-and-bound procedure was developed for a FMS scheduling problem with arbitrary number of machining centers. It was demonstrated that this algorithm has the capability of solving problem instances 10 times as size as ones the previous algorithms can solve.
(4) A new planing problem that arises in an AS/RS was formulated, and approximate algorithms were proposed based on the graph theory.
(5) A few mathematical properties were found for a Markov process that is a basic stochastic one of scheduling for probabilistic scheduling problems in FMS.
